What is recredentialing requirements?
Recredentialing requirements are the process of updating and verifying a healthcare provider's credentials or qualifications.
Who is required to file recredentialing requirements?
Healthcare providers such as doctors, nurses, and allied health professionals are required to file recredentialing requirements.
How to fill out recredentialing requirements?
Healthcare providers can fill out recredentialing requirements by providing updated information on their education, training, licensure, and work experience.
What is the purpose of recredentialing requirements?
The purpose of recredentialing requirements is to ensure that healthcare providers maintain the necessary qualifications and competency to provide quality care to patients.
What information must be reported on recredentialing requirements?
Information such as education, training, licensure, work experience, certifications, and any disciplinary actions must be reported on recredentialing requirements.
